China zhejiang hangzhou Ali cloud
Websites on 121.40.180.15
- Domain names that have been bound:
- 2022-09-02-----2024-09-25582y.com
- 2023-08-24-----2024-09-25dys123.com
- 2022-08-02-----2024-08-20w760.com
- 2023-04-04-----2024-04-1394696.com
- 2023-08-24-----2024-03-06dayouweng.com
- 2023-04-05-----2024-01-08www.w760.com
- 2023-04-29-----2023-10-30www.94696.com
- 2023-08-28-----2023-08-28meitongku.com
- website server lookup history
- support.maptiler.com
- www.s515i.com
- help.bluestacks.com
- xxx98.com
- 52g.app
- 49tk009.com
- gogo3x.net
- betwos2.com
- hdhole.com
- www.chinaaffairs.org
- www.boxun.com
- www.googie.com
- 67777.com
- ydaan.cc
- www.8as9.com
- av551.com
- myhtebook.com
- 5t9s.com
- www.9kh5.com
- 91ss8.com
- hosting ip address lookup history
- 172.67.206.106
- 18.162.211.211
- 18.162.165.39
- 18.162.135.94
- 18.162.124.14
- 18.162.106.30
- 103.229.64.186
- 18.161.6.59
- 18.161.6.25
- 18.161.6.113
- 216.239.38.223
- 182.61.129.104
- 173.194.219.188
- 18.155.68.70
- 18.155.68.47
- 67.228.37.26
- 64.64.238.61
- 64.64.231.43
- 62.60.174.25
- 18.155.68.40